A natural gas flow meter is a very common type of flow meter; its existence has brought great convenience to the measurement industry and trade settlement, and it is indeed a highly practical flow meter. 1. Inner wall deposit layer: Natural gas flow meters need to be used in many environments with suspended particles or debris, and as a result they suffer more damage compared to other types of instruments. Deposits easily form on the inner walls, and if these are not removed over time, they can affect the proper functioning of the natural gas flow meter. 2. Lightning strike: If a lightning strike occurs, it will enter the instrument and cause it to become loose. Lightning strikes generally enter the instrument through the power cables, sensors, and excitation wires; therefore, it is essential to take proper lightning protection measures at these locations to avoid malfunctions during use. 3. Environmental factors: If a natural gas flow meter is disturbed by new magnetic waves during use, it will be affected in its normal operation, and sometimes the output signal may experience significant fluctuations. Everyone must be careful when using it, and avoid interference from the surrounding environment. Although some of the common faults in natural gas flowmeters are unavoidable, as long as we prepare in advance, they can still operate properly without experiencing any failures.
